Millions in state funding aimed at getting people off the streets

Kern County is getting a handout to give the homeless a hand up. The state is giving the county millions of dollars to get people off the streets. "We're seeing this all up and down California, that there is a crisis," said Jessica Janssen, manager of homeless projects for the Kern County Homeless Collaborative. Kern County isn't immune. Homelessness here is up 9 percent. Path to Full Story on 29 Eyewitness News
